diff --git a/Tracking/TrkDetDescr/TrkDetDescrAlgs/CMakeLists.txt b/Tracking/TrkDetDescr/TrkDetDescrAlgs/CMakeLists.txt new file mode 100644 index 0000000000000000000000000000000000000000..5fde413840f5c7bd556bd9f3223f0a3a6f0a0cb2 --- /dev/null +++ b/Tracking/TrkDetDescr/TrkDetDescrAlgs/CMakeLists.txt @@ -0,0 +1,36 @@ +################################################################################ +# Package: TrkDetDescrAlgs +################################################################################ + +# Declare the package name: +atlas_subdir( TrkDetDescrAlgs ) + +# Declare the package's dependencies: +atlas_depends_on_subdirs( PUBLIC + Control/AthenaBaseComps + DetectorDescription/GeoPrimitives + GaudiKernel + Tracking/TrkDetDescr/TrkDetDescrUtils + PRIVATE + Tracking/TrkDetDescr/TrkDetDescrInterfaces + Tracking/TrkDetDescr/TrkGeometry + Tracking/TrkDetDescr/TrkVolumes + Tracking/TrkEvent/TrkNeutralParameters + Tracking/TrkExtrapolation/TrkExInterfaces ) + +# External dependencies: +find_package( Eigen ) +find_package( ROOT COMPONENTS Core Tree MathCore Hist RIO pthread ) + +# tag use_trkdetdescr_memmon was not recognized in automatic conversion in cmt2cmake + +# Component(s) in the package: +atlas_add_component( TrkDetDescrAlgs + src/*.cxx + src/components/*.cxx + INCLUDE_DIRS ${ROOT_INCLUDE_DIRS} ${EIGEN_INCLUDE_DIRS} + LINK_LIBRARIES ${ROOT_LIBRARIES} ${EIGEN_LIBRARIES} AthenaBaseComps GeoPrimitives GaudiKernel TrkDetDescrUtils TrkDetDescrInterfaces TrkGeometry TrkVolumes TrkNeutralParameters TrkExInterfaces ) + +# Install files from the package: +atlas_install_headers( TrkDetDescrAlgs ) + diff --git a/Tracking/TrkDetDescr/TrkDetDescrAlgs/src/MaterialMapping.cxx b/Tracking/TrkDetDescr/TrkDetDescrAlgs/src/MaterialMapping.cxx index 1d81e509f74f23e139ccbaf6f3c17ca0ba2a430a..81917cfa31d4465ba0a3e57a2407630bec48aea5 100755 --- a/Tracking/TrkDetDescr/TrkDetDescrAlgs/src/MaterialMapping.cxx +++ b/Tracking/TrkDetDescr/TrkDetDescrAlgs/src/MaterialMapping.cxx @@ -62,6 +62,7 @@ Trk::MaterialMapping::MaterialMapping(const std::string& name, ISvcLocator* pSvc m_elementTable(0), m_inputEventElementTable("ElementTable"), m_accumulatedMaterialXX0(0.), + m_accumulatedRhoS(0.), m_mapped(0), m_unmapped(0), m_skippedOutside(0),